Mechanical Fitter, Workington Adecco is delighted to be recruiting for our client based in Workington who are looking for a permanent Mechanical Fitter to join their team. Working 8.00am - 16.00pm Monday - Friday, plus a weekend on call. Starting salary 39,810 per annum plus call out overtime rate in place. Approx 1 weekend in 4 on a rota system. Purpose of the role To be responsible for the safe and effective maintenance of the facilities within the scope of the mechanical discipline. Assist with the completion of Preventative and Predictive Maintenance Schedules and the development of forward plans to improve the reliability of critical assets. To assist the Mechanical Supervisor in the execution of his daily tasks and step up to provide absence cover for aspects of the Mechanical Supervisor's role. Technical: Execute the mechanical maintenance tasks as required, including both planned and emergent work. Tasks will include but are not limited to, installation of pipework and fittings, installation of screwed and bolted joints, installation and alignment of rotating machinery (pumps, agitators etc.), condition-based monitoring, pump and valve overhauls/repairs. Identify any parts required, collating the relevant details and where appropriate, contacting the supplier for a quotation. Experience of fitting glassware would be an advantage. Assist in the development of Predictive and Preventative Maintenance Routines (PMR) and write appropriate routines so that others can carry out the task. Contribute to Root Cause Analysis of failures both formally and more generally through discussion with others and the Maintenance Supervisor in order to improve the reliability of equipment. Ensure the Mechanical section of the Workshop Tier Board is up to date, clearly identifying both planned and breakdown work, indicating the current status and who is working on the task. Recommend and monitor workshop spares holding, ensuring any parts used are replenished. Record all work in the Computerised Maintenance Management System (MMS) currently MP2. Assist where required in the training of others on site in order to increase the skills and knowledge of the workforce in order to better execute their roles. Ensure all work is carried out in a safe manner and without harm to others or the environment, in line with Company policies. Provide cover for the Mechanical Maintenance Supervisor during absences and at other times as required. To undertake other duties as may be required. Compliance: To understand the MAPP - Major Accident Prevention Policy / Plan and Safety and Environment Management Systems. To comply with company Health, Safety and Environmental policies, procedures and arrangements. Where applicable, to inspect before use, and use correctly, the plant equipment, machinery and personal protective equipment provided, and take corrective action within your competency level and report to line management any defects identified. To report all Health, Safety and Environmental accidents, incidents and near misses promptly. To act in a safe and responsible manner at all times. Not to use any new equipment or carry out any modification or change of process or system of work, without first ensuring that adequate assessment and authorisation has been carried out through the Management of Change procedure. Where appropriate, to only undertake work for which you have been appropriately trained. In the event of an abnormal situation or emergency, to carry out the necessary actions to ensure your own safety and that of others, in accordance with the site Emergency Procedures, and to be available to be part of the Emergency Response Team in line with your training, specialist skills and Departmental expertise. Business Improvement: Active participation in continuous improvement and other lean manufacturing initiatives. Participation in problem solving. To take responsibility for own learning and development in the spirit of continuous improvement of both self and the business. To assist in the training, mentoring and assessment of other team members. To exercise autonomy and judgement subject to overall direction or guidance. What are we looking for? Served a recognised apprenticeship scheme or equivalent training. Experience and knowledge of rotating equipment (centrifugal pumps, mechanical seals etc.). Experience and knowledge of static equipment (flanges, pipework, valves, PVVs, RVs, flame arresters, etc.). Knowledge of predictive techniques. Knowledge & Skills: General good knowledge of maintenance processes. Good IT Skills - able to adapt to new IT systems. Detail oriented and well organised, able to prioritise and handle multiple tasks. Effective oral and written communication skills.
